Microneedling, additionally called collagen induction treatment, entails the use of a tool that has little needles that make little pricks in the leading layer of the skin. Microneedling tools include a dermapen or dermaroller. Collagen induction treatments, which are considered minimally invasive, are executed in a skin doctor or aesthetician's office.


The needles generally gauge someplace from 0.5 to 2 millimeters in size. Microneedling can likewise be done at home with specialized devices. This therapy is also understood as collagen induction therapy because it's known for improving collagen production in the skin, which can make it valuable for a variety of skin concerns including great lines and creases.

There a number of possible advantages of this treatment consisting of: As I simply pointed out, collagen production in the skin is critical to our skin's appearance. Much less collagen as we age implies even more creases, great lines and skin sagging. So more collagen implies an extra vibrant skin tone, and research study reveals that microneedling can in fact increase collagen manufacturing/ According to a 2008 research, clients treated with one to four microneedling sessions and topical vitamin A and C aesthetic hanker a minimum of four weeks preoperatively experienced "substantial increase in collagen and elastin deposition" 6 months after finishing treatment.

Microneedling or collagen induction treatment is a minimally intrusive skin therapy in which a dermatologist or aesthetician purposefully creates tiny slits in the top layer of skin using micro-fine needles (collagen microneedling). The regulated skin injuries created by this treatment send out the skin into a fixing mode that sets off the body to produce brand-new collagen as well as elastin.


You can execute microneedling at home with a dermaroller, however both home and in-office treatments must not take place greater than once a month. Microneedling is not suggested if you have: have energetic acne; cold sores, excrescences or various other skin infections; a persistent skin problem such as dermatitis or psoriasis; a tendency towards keloidal scars; a blood condition or problem.
